Cod sursa(job #8767)
Utilizator | Data | 25 ianuarie 2007 15:50:29 | |
---|---|---|---|
Problema | Cifre | Scor | 0 |
Compilator | cpp | Status | done |
Runda | Arhiva de probleme | Marime | 0.33 kb |
#include<fstream.h>
#include<iomanip.h>
main()
{ifstream f("cifre.in");
ofstream g("cifre.out");
int a,b,i,c,k,x,d,e,p=0;
f>>a>>b>>c>>k;
for(i=a;i<=b;i++)
{x=i;d=0;
while(x!=0) {e=x%10;
x=x/10;
if(e==c) d++;}
if(d>=k) p++;}
p=p/(b-a+1);
g<<setprecision(4)<<p;
return 0;}